McDonald’s Coffee Customers Most Loyal

McDonald’s Coffee Customers Most Loyal

In a study comparing McDonald’s, Starbucks and Dunkin’ Donuts customers, McDonald’s coffee customers are the least likely to stray. McDonald’s coffee customers are the most loyal compared to those who frequent Starbucks Corp. and Dunkin’ Donuts, a study by market research firm CustomersDNA LLC found. Starbucks Partners With Green Mountain Coffee Roasters

Starbucks Partners With Green Mountain Coffee Roasters

Starbucks to be the exclusive licensed super-premium coffee brand produced by GMCR for the Keurig Single-Cup Brewing System. Starbucks Turns 40

Starbucks Turns 40

New Starbucks Petites, a line of eight sweets is rolling out at stores now. Starbucks is celebrating its 40th birthday this month, having opened its first store in Seattle on March 30, 1971.
